The Men's FIH Hockey World Cup represents the absolute pinnacle of international field hockey. As the 2026 Hockey World Cup matches unfold across Belgium and the Netherlands from August 15 to August 30, 2026, the global hockey community is focused on who will next hoist the coveted trophy. Below is the definitive, up-to-date hockey world cup winners list tracking every champion since the tournament's inception in 1971.



Year Host Nation Champion Runner-up
2026 Belgium & Netherlands Ongoing (Final Aug 30) TBD
2023 India Germany Belgium
2018 India Belgium Netherlands
2014 Netherlands Australia Netherlands
2010 India Australia Germany
2006 Germany Germany Australia
2002 Malaysia Germany Australia
1998 Netherlands Netherlands Spain
1994 Australia Pakistan Netherlands
1990 Pakistan Netherlands Pakistan
1986 England Australia England
1982 India Pakistan West Germany
1978 Argentina Pakistan Netherlands
1975 Malaysia India Pakistan
1973 Netherlands Netherlands India
1971 Spain Pakistan Spain

Dominant Dynasties and Global Field Hockey Evolution

The landscape of international hockey has shifted dramatically over the last five decades. Pakistan remains the most successful nation in World Cup history with four titles, though their last gold medal came in 1994. In recent decades, European powerhouses and Australia have dominated the podium, showcasing tactical evolution and elite athletic conditioning.



  • The European Ascent: Germany and the Netherlands have consistently stayed at the top, with Germany claiming their third title in a thrilling shootout against Belgium in 2023.
  • The Kookaburras' Reign: Australia has claimed three titles (1986, 2010, 2014) and remains one of the most feared teams in modern tournament play.
  • Belgium's Golden Era: Achieving their first title in 2018, Belgium solidified their status as a global superpower, backed by structured youth academies and a highly disciplined squad.
